As mentioned in another thread, I finally found an affordable LX 2000 and purchased it. It didn't come with the "Special" 50mm f/1.2 lens, which is probably why it was within my budget, and I already have an A 50 1.2. Yes, I really want a silver A 50 1.2, but not for $1000.


It also didn't include the soft shutter release. With the help of a friend I 3D-printed some test soft releases and after a few adjustments printed them with black resin. Then I sanded the soft releases with 2000-grit sandpaper. I designed the LX lettering to be lower than the surface of the button. There are three coats of red polyurethane cured under UV lights, and one layer of glossy clear coat. The resin is slightly translucent. I also sanded one button again after the clear coat to remove the glossy surface so I can have one glossy and one matte release.

I figured while I was making these I should make a few extras in case some here would be interested in them. I have never seen the original LX soft shutter release so I don't know how mine compare, but I'm happy with the result. If there is interest, I'll create a listing in the Marketplace.

Lastly, the Pentecost River Crossing. A rather iconic final hurdle for the 4WD adventure of driving the Gibb River Road.

Also full of salties ( salt water crocs ), which I only later found out after having walked the crossing plenty of times trying for the perfect sunset.

First is 50R and Pentax 55mm, shifted and stitched. Some tilt applied for full depth of field.

Second and third were almost the sunset I was hoping for, but the clouds moved a little too far north. Still, low wind meant for good reflections off the river beside the crossing. Credo 60 and Pentax 28-45mm, exposure blended, and 50R with Pentax 35mm, single exposure. ND filter used for both.

Fourth is of the crossing itself, looking across the river with the Cockburns in the background. Credo with Pentax 28-45mm, Grad ND filter and CPL, focus stacked.

Fifth is with the 50R and 55mm. Tilt applied meant I didn't need to focus stack; the more I use this feature, the more I appreciate its usefulness. Grad ND, shifted and stitched.

Sixth was well after sunset, with the afterglow behind me colouring the foreground and the last light on the high cloud overhead. 50R and Pentax 35mm. Focus stacked, shifted and stitched.

Seventh was Credo and Pentax 28-45mm. I haven't fully warmed to the 4:3 ratio, but I tend to find it fits my purposes more frequently in vertical orientation; sometimes remarkably well. Focus stacked.

I do too. I keep battery grips on my *ist, MZ-3, and MZ-S. For years it bothered me Pentax would use CR2 batteries due to their price and lack of availability compared to AA batteries. But then I started using a Nikon F5 requiring 8 AAs. The data back uses two 2025 batteries. This adds a lot of weight and bulk to an already large and heavy camera, and 8 AAs don't last long.

I now understand why Pentax went with CR2s.

Tumulla Bank, in the NSW Central West region of Australia, has always been one of the state's famously fearsome gradients. Even using modern diesels, it's quite impressive to watch huge loads being dragged up the 1 in 40 grade.

Last weekend, Transport Heritage NSW ran a series of steam-hauled trains using a 36 class and a 35 class. It just happened to coincide with sub-zero temperatures (in Celsius), frost, mist and sparkling sunshine.

GFX100S with Pentax 67 55-100mm lens @ 55mm
